Earthquakes shake rattle and roll

Earthquakes is a fun packed activity book about how and why earthquakes occur. The surface of the Earth is covered with crustal plates. You live on one of these plates as they move around on the surface of the Earth.

The activities in this book show how the Earth's plates can move upward, downward, and slip past another plate. All of these actions cause the plates where you live to shake, rattle, and roll.
